WebMar 14, 2024 · Only one problem: when Jello-O sets in a typical gelatin mold made of silicone and polymers, there’s no space for air, which means no vacuum and nothing to break the seal holding the gelatin in. But just a little heat warms Jell-O enough to release it from the mold without altering its shape. ions important for living thingsWebFill a large pan with hot water and set the mold in the water for about ten seconds.
